When it comes to price and running costs, the biggest differences usually appear. This is often where you see which car fits your budget better in the long run.
Lexus LBX is noticeably cheaper – starting at 28,300 £ , while the Fiat Ulysse costs 38,200 £ . That’s a price difference of around 9,943 £.
Fuel consumption also shows a difference: the Lexus LBX uses 4.5 L/100km and is considerably more efficient than the Fiat Ulysse with 7.1 L/100km. The difference is about 2.6 L/100km.
Power, torque and acceleration say a lot about how a car feels on the road. This is where you see which model delivers more driving dynamics.
When it comes to engine power, the Fiat Ulysse offers noticeably more power – delivering 180 HP compared to 136 HP. That’s roughly 44 HP more horsepower.
There’s also a difference in torque: the Fiat Ulysse delivers clearly more torque with 400 Nm compared to 185 Nm. That’s about 215 Nm more.
Whether family car or daily driver – which one offers more room, flexibility and comfort?
Seats: Fiat Ulysse offers more seats – 8 vs 5.
In terms of curb weight, Lexus LBX is significantly lighter – 1,280 kg compared to 1,946 kg. The difference is around 666 kg.
Looking at boot space, the Fiat Ulysse offers significantly more boot space – 800 L compared to 332 L. That’s a difference of about 468 L.
When it comes to payload, the Fiat Ulysse carries significantly more – 924 kg compared to 475 kg. That’s a difference of about 449 kg.

The Lexus LBX is a compact premium crossover that brings Lexus styling and craftsmanship to city driving, pairing a cozy interior with thoughtful tech and upscale materials. It focuses on a quiet, refined ride and fuel-efficient everyday usability while carrying the brand’s familiar emphasis on comfort and safety.
detailsThe Fiat Ulysse is a versatile minivan that caters to family needs with its spacious interior and practical design. Known for its comfortable seating and flexibility, it provides a strong option for those seeking a reliable and accommodating vehicle for everyday journeys. With its emphasis on functionality and comfort, the Ulysse remains an attractive choice for larger households or those who regularly travel with groups.
